Well, at least wait until te next book is out before committing. WFB is a lot of fun, but it takes more models than many 40K armies, so it's slightly more pricy. The ruleset is a little more mature and most of the armies were fairly well balanced until the release of the High Elves and everything after (especially Vampire Counts & Daemons) skewed the power curve.
